New, updated, and deprecated options in Ocata for Networking

New, updated, and deprecated options in Ocata for Networking

New options
Option = default value (Type) Help string
[DEFAULT] allow_automatic_lbaas_agent_failover = False (BoolOpt) Automatically reschedule loadbalancer from offline to online lbaas agents. This is only supported for drivers who use the neutron LBaaSv2 agent
[DEFAULT] device_driver = ['neutron_lbaas.drivers.haproxy.namespace_driver.HaproxyNSDriver'] (MultiStrOpt) Drivers used to manage loadbalancing devices
[DEFAULT] ha_vrrp_health_check_interval = 0 (IntOpt) The VRRP health check interval in seconds. Values > 0 enable VRRP health checks. Setting it to 0 disables VRRP health checks. Recommended value is 5. This will cause pings to be sent to the gateway IP address(es) - requires ICMP_ECHO_REQUEST to be enabled on the gateway. If gateway fails, all routers will be reported as master, and master election will be repeated in round-robin fashion, until one of the router restore the gateway connection.
[DEFAULT] loadbalancer_scheduler_driver = neutron_lbaas.agent_scheduler.ChanceScheduler (StrOpt) Driver to use for scheduling to a default loadbalancer agent

[haproxy] jinja_config_template = /usr/lib/python/site-packages/neutron-lbaas/neutron_lbaas/drivers/haproxy/templates/haproxy.loadbalancer.j2 (StrOpt) Jinja template file for haproxy configuration
[haproxy] loadbalancer_state_path = $state_path/lbaas (StrOpt) Location to store config and state files
[haproxy] send_gratuitous_arp = 3 (IntOpt) When delete and re-add the same vip, send this many gratuitous ARPs to flush the ARP cache in the Router. Set it below or equal to 0 to disable this feature.
[haproxy] user_group = nogroup (StrOpt) The user group
[octavia] allocates_vip = False (BoolOpt) True if Octavia will be responsible for allocating the VIP. False if neutron-lbaas will allocate it and pass to Octavia.
[octavia] base_url = http://127.0.0.1:9876 (StrOpt) URL of Octavia controller root
[octavia] request_poll_interval = 3 (IntOpt) Interval in seconds to poll octavia when an entity is created, updated, or deleted.
[octavia] request_poll_timeout = 100 (IntOpt) Time to stop polling octavia when a status of an entity does not change.

New default values
Option Previous default value New default value
[DEFAULT] ha_keepalived_state_change_server_threads 1 (1 + <num_of_cpus>) / 2
Deprecated options
Deprecated option New Option
[DEFAULT] rpc_thread_pool_size [DEFAULT] executor_thread_pool_size
[DEFAULT] use_syslog None
